#header { 
	height: 200px; 
	background:url(http://www.projectfinale.com/library/badass/bgtop.jpg) repeat-x 0 100% #FFFFFF; 
}
#footer {  
	background:url(http://www.projectfinale.com/library/badass/footer.jpg) repeat-x 0 100% #FFFFFF; 
}
td.footer { 
	background:url(http://www.projectfinale.com/library/badass/footer.jpg) repeat-x 0 100% #FFFFFF; 
}

input.button {
	background-color: #000000;
	font-weight: bold; 
	font-size: 10px; 
	color: white;
	border:solid 1px #CCCCCC;
}

td.links {
	font-family:"Lucida Grande",Helvetica,Arial,Verdana,sans-serif;
	font-size:12px;
	font-weight: bold;
	color: #FFFFFF;
}
td.links a {
	color: #FFFFFF;
	text-decoration: none;
}
td.links a:hover {
	color: #5274CC;
	text-decoration: none;
}
.show-name{
	font-family:"Lucida Grande",Helvetica,Arial,Verdana,sans-serif;
	font-weight:normal;
	font-size:16px;
	color:#444444;
}
td.descrip{
	font-family:"Lucida Grande",Helvetica,Arial,Verdana,sans-serif;
	font-weight:normal;
	font-size:11px;
	color:#666666;
}
td.descrip a{
	font-family:"Lucida Grande",Helvetica,Arial,Verdana,sans-serif;
	font-weight:bold;
	text-decoration: none;
	font-size:12px;
	color:#5274CC;
}
td.descrip a:hover{
	font-family:"Lucida Grande",Helvetica,Arial,Verdana,sans-serif;
	font-weight:bold;
	text-decoration: none;
	font-size:12px;
	color:#0066FF;
}
td.bodyMain {
	font-family:"Lucida Grande",Helvetica,Arial,Verdana,sans-serif;
	font-size:11px;
	color: #555555;
}
td.bodyMain a {
	color: #5274A8;
	text-decoration: none;
}
td.bodyMain a:hover {
	color: #5274CC;
	text-decoration: none;
}



/* Everything below applies to the tutorials */
.show-name{
	font-family:"Lucida Grande",Helvetica,Arial,Verdana,sans-serif;
	font-weight:normal;
	font-size:16px;
	color:#444444;
}
.tut_comment {
	font-family:"Lucida Grande",Helvetica,Arial,Verdana,sans-serif;
	font-size:11px;
	color:#333333;
	width: 335px;
	background: #FFFFFF;
	padding: 3px 10px 3px;
	position: relative;
	border-top: solid 1px #DDDDDD;
}
td.mainFont {
	font-family:"Lucida Grande",Helvetica,Arial,Verdana,sans-serif;
	font-size:12px;
	color: #666666;
}
td.mainFont a {
	font-family:"Lucida Grande",Helvetica,Arial,Verdana,sans-serif;
	color: #5274A8;
	text-decoration: none;
}
td.mainFont a:hover {
	font-family:"Lucida Grande",Helvetica,Arial,Verdana,sans-serif;
	color: #5274CC;
	text-decoration: none;
}

/* Everything below applies to the blog */
td.blogMain {
	font-family:"Lucida Grande",Helvetica,Arial,Verdana,sans-serif;
	font-size:12px;
	color: #555555;
}
td.blogMain a {
	color: #5274A8;
	text-decoration: none;
}
td.blogMain a:hover {
	color: #5274CC;
	text-decoration: none;
}
.rsstitle {
	font-family:"Lucida Grande",Helvetica,Arial,Verdana,sans-serif;
	font-size:12px;
	font-weight: bold;
	color:#333333;
}
.rsstime {
	font-family:"Lucida Grande",Helvetica,Arial,Verdana,sans-serif;
	font-size:10px;
	color:#CCCCCC;
	padding-bottom:4px;
	padding-top:0px;
	border-top:solid 1px #CCCCCC;
}
.latest_left {
	font-family:"Lucida Grande",Helvetica,Arial,Verdana,sans-serif;
	font-size:11px;
	font-weight: bold;
	color:#666666;
}
.latest_right {
	font-family:"Lucida Grande",Helvetica,Arial,Verdana,sans-serif;
	font-size:10px;
	color:#999999;
	text-decoration: none;
}
.latest_right a{
	font-family:"Lucida Grande",Helvetica,Arial,Verdana,sans-serif;
	font-size:10px;
	color:#999999;
	text-decoration: none;
}
.latest_right a:hover{
	font-family:"Lucida Grande",Helvetica,Arial,Verdana,sans-serif;
	font-size:10px;
	color:#999999;
}
.rightbartitle {
	font-family:"Lucida Grande",Helvetica,Arial,Verdana,sans-serif;
	font-size:12px;
	font-weight: bold;
	color:#333333;
	width: 265px;
	border-bottom:solid 1px #CCCCCC;
}
.comment_post {
	font-family:"Lucida Grande",Helvetica,Arial,Verdana,sans-serif;
	font-size:11px;
	color:#333333;
	width: 410px;
	background: #FFFFFF;
	padding: 0px 0px 3px;
	position: relative;
}
.comment {
	font-family:"Lucida Grande",Helvetica,Arial,Verdana,sans-serif;
	font-size:12px;
	color:#333333;
	width: 410px;
	background: #FFFFFF;
	position: relative;
}
td.rightBar {
	font-family:"Lucida Grande",Helvetica,Arial,Verdana,sans-serif;
	font-size:11px;
	color: #555555;
}
td.rightBar a {
	color: #5274A8;
	text-decoration: none;
}
td.rightBar a:hover {
	color: #5274CC;
	text-decoration: none;
}





.panetop {
	font-size:11px; 
	font-family: Arial; 
	color:#FFFFFF;
	width: 790px;
	background: #333333;
	padding: 3px 10px 3px;
	position: relative;
	border-top: solid 1px #c4df9b;
	border-left: solid 1px #c4df9b;
	border-right: solid 1px #c4df9b;
	border-bottom: solid 1px #c4df9b;
}
.paneupload {
	font-size:11px; 
	font-family: Arial; 
	color:#333333;
	width: 770px;
	background: #edf5e1;
	padding: 3px 10px 3px;
	position: relative;
	border-top: solid 1px #c4df9b;
	border-left: solid 1px #c4df9b;
	border-right: solid 1px #c4df9b;
	border-bottom: solid 1px #c4df9b;
}

.pane {
	font-size:11px; 
	font-family: Arial; 
	color:#333333;
	width: 790px;
	background: #FFFFFF;
	padding: 3px 10px 3px;
	position: relative;
}
td.panefont{
	font: 11px Arial;
	color: #333333;
}
td.panefont a {
	font: Arial;
	color: #333333;
	text-decoration: none;
}
td.panefont a:hover {
	font: Arial;
	color: #000000;
	text-decoration: none;
}
.rght {
	font-size:11px; 
	font-family: Arial; 
	color:#333333;
	width: 210px;
	background: #edf5e1;
	border-top: solid 1px #c4df9b;
	border-left: solid 1px #c4df9b;
	border-right: solid 1px #c4df9b;
	border-bottom: solid 1px #c4df9b;
}
.pane2 {
	font-size:11px; 
	font-family: Arial; 
	color:#333333;
	width: 790px;
	background: #E8E8E8;
	padding: 3px 10px 3px;
	position: relative;
}
.pane .delete {
	cursor: pointer;
}
.pane2 .delete {
	cursor: pointer;
}
#screenshot {
	margin: 0;
	padding: 8px;
	position: absolute;
	border: 1px solid #122025;
	background: #000;
	display: none;
	z-index: 200;
}
#screenshot img {
	width: 200px;
}

.abouttitle {
	font-family:"Lucida Grande",Helvetica,Arial,Verdana,sans-serif;
	font-size:12px;
	font-weight: bold;
	color:#333333;
	width: 480px;
	border-bottom:solid 1px #CCCCCC;
}

.aboutrighttitle {
	font-family:"Lucida Grande",Helvetica,Arial,Verdana,sans-serif;
	font-size:12px;
	font-weight: bold;
	color:#333333;
	width: 220px;
	border-bottom:solid 1px #CCCCCC;
}

td.tutdescrip{
	font-family:"Lucida Grande",Helvetica,Arial,Verdana,sans-serif;
	font-weight:normal;
	font-size:12px;
	color:#666666;
}
td.tutdescrip a{
	font-family:"Lucida Grande",Helvetica,Arial,Verdana,sans-serif;
	font-weight:bold;
	text-decoration: none;
	font-size:12px;
	color:#5274CC;
}
td.tutdescrip a:hover{
	font-family:"Lucida Grande",Helvetica,Arial,Verdana,sans-serif;
	font-weight:bold;
	text-decoration: none;
	font-size:12px;
	color:#0066FF;
}



.reg_resR {
	font-size:11px; 
	font-family: Arial; 
	color:#990000;
	width: 400px;
	padding-top: 10px;
	padding-bottom:10px;
	background: #E77F83;
	border-top: solid 1px #990000;
	border-left: solid 1px #990000;
	border-right: solid 1px #990000;
	border-bottom: solid 1px #990000;
}

.reg_resG {
	font-size:11px; 
	font-family: Arial; 
	color:#009932;
	width: 400px;
	padding-top: 10px;
	padding-bottom:10px;
	background: #97E795;
	border-top: solid 1px #009932;
	border-left: solid 1px #009932;
	border-right: solid 1px #009932;
	border-bottom: solid 1px #009932;
}
